Job Description

Job Overview:

We are seeking an exceptional Restaurant Chef to lead our Ala Carte dining for our exclusive family country club in Greenwich CT. The ideal candidate will bring pedigree and brand recognition, extensive a la carte experience, and the ability to manage high-volume, upscale cuisine while fostering a culture of excellence and mentorship. This role requires a leader who can balance creativity with efficiency, ensuring a world-class dining experience for our distinguished members.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Culinary Excellence & Menu Development:
  • Design and execute an exceptional, versatile a la carte menu catering to diverse palates while maintaining the highest quality standards.
  • Innovate seasonal offerings and special dining experiences using premium, locally sourced ingredients.
  • Maintain consistency in flavor, presentation, and portioning across all dishes.
  • Leadership & Team Development:
  • Recruit, train, and mentor a high-performing culinary team, fostering a culture of learning and excellence.
  • Provide ongoing training to kitchen staff, ensuring professional growth and high morale.
  • Uphold a respectful and positive kitchen environment aligned with the club’s values.
  • Operational Management & Quality Control:
  • Oversee day-to-day kitchen operations, ensuring efficiency during high-volume service while maintaining impeccable food quality.
  • Develop and enforce standardized recipes, procedures, and kitchen best practices.
  • Ensure compliance with all health and safety regulations, maintaining a pristine kitchen environment.
  • Strategic Vision & Member Engagement:
  • Enhance the club’s culinary reputation by introducing innovative dining concepts and signature dishes.
  • Represent the restaurant’s brand and engage with members to foster excitement and loyalty.
  • Work closely with the club’s management team to align culinary offerings with overall member experience goals.

Qualifications & Requirements:

  • Proven experience as a Chef de Cuisine, Executive Chef, or in a comparable leadership role at a high-end fine dining establishment.
  • A strong culinary pedigree from a prestigious culinary institution or renowned restaurant brand.
  • Extensive a la carte experience with the ability to execute a sophisticated and diverse menu.
  • Demonstrated success in managing high-volume service while upholding upscale dining standards.
  • Strong leadership, mentorship, and team-building skills.
  • Proficiency in sourcing and utilizing high-quality, seasonal ingredients with an emphasis on sustainability.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ills, ensuring smooth kitchen operations during peak service hours.
  • Ability to recruit and retain top culinary talent, leveraging industry connections and networks.
  • Strong understanding of financial management, food cost control, and waste reduction strategies.
  • Availability to start within 4 weeks, with flexible work schedule.

Compensation & Benefits:

  • Competitive salary commensurate with experience.
  • Comprehensive benefits package, including health insurance and retirement plans.
  • Opportunities for professional development and career growth.
  • Access to exclusive club amenities and events.
